1. Academy of Combat
About the Business
Academy of Combat, established in 1992 and located in Sydenham, is Christchurch’s premier martial arts academy. Led by Chief Instructor Dr. Geoff Aitken, Ph.D., a globally recognized martial arts expert, the academy emphasizes self-discipline, fitness, and practical self-defense. Affiliated with the Aesir Sport Science Institute, it supports martial arts development locally and internationally, offering a supportive environment for all skill levels.
Key Services / What They Offer
They provide classes in Mixed Martial Arts (MMA),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u (BJJ), Muay Thai Kickboxing, Freestyle Martial Arts, and Street Self-Defense. Specialized programs include Women’s Only Thai Kickboxing and Kids’ Martial Arts, with private lessons available. Their facilities feature a 3/4-size MMA cage, a full-size Thai boxing ring, and 1500 square feet of grappling mats, ensuring top-tier training.

2. Proactive Martial Arts Cashmere
About the Business
Proactive Martial Arts Cashmere, based at the Cashmere Club since 1991, is a family-run martial arts school known for its welcoming, community-focused approach. Affiliated with BJMA Australia and WKA, their highly qualified instructors deliver life-skill-focused training, fostering confidence, discipline, and fitness in a purpose-built facility.
Key Services / What They Offer
They offer programs including Tiny Tigers Karate (ages 3-5), Tigers and Panthers Karate (ages 6-12), Teenage Martial Arts, Muay Thai Kickboxing, Krav Maga, Freestyle Martial Arts, and Boxing Fit. Classes incorporate drills, games, and self-defense techniques, with complimentary trial sessions available for all ages.

3. Shizoku Martial Arts
About the Business
Shizoku Martial Arts, operating across Christchurch and North Canterbury, is a family-centric karate club founded on the principle of “Shizoku” (family). Their Freestyle Martial Arts System (FMAS) blends traditional and modern techniques, emphasizing life skills like confidence, respect, and focus, delivered in a fun, engaging environment.
Key Services / What They Offer
They provide Little Dragons Karate (ages 4-7), Youth Karate (ages 8-12), Adult Karate, and Self-Defense classes. Their FMAS incorporates Okinawa Te Karate, Kempo, Jiu-Jitsu, Krav Maga, and Kickboxing, with complimentary trial classes offered. Programs focus on fitness, self-defense, and personal development.

4. The Kung Fu School – Burnside
About the Business
The Kung Fu School – Burnside, located at Fendalton Community Centre, is a respected Christchurch academy specializing in Shaolin Kung Fu. Led by experienced instructors, they teach traditional martial arts and weapon use, fostering self-esteem, discipline, and respect in a fun, inclusive environment suitable for all ages.
Key Services / What They Offer
They offer Kung Fu classes for kids (ages 7+), teens, and adults, covering hand techniques, kicks, forms, and traditional weapons like staffs and swords. Programs emphasize self-defense, fitness, and classic martial arts values, with free trial classes available to experience their engaging approach.

5. Inception Academy of Martial Arts
About the Business
Inception Academy of Martial Arts, based in Halswell-Wigram, is a family-oriented school specializing in BJMA Zen Do Kai, a freestyle martial art blending Krav Maga, Jiu-Jitsu, Muay Thai, and Kickboxing. With over 100 years of combined instructor experience, they focus on practical self-defense, fitness, and mental discipline, fostering growth in a supportive community.
Key Services / What They Offer
They provide classes for kids (ages 4-14), teens, and adults, covering Zen Do Kai Freestyle, Muay Thai,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u, and Krav Maga. Programs emphasize self-defense for real-world scenarios, with age-specific curricula addressing bullying, coordination, and confidence. Trial classes are offered to new students.

Choosing the Right Martial Arts School in Christchurch
- Identify Your Goals: Determine whether you’re looking for fitness, self-defense, competition, discipline, or a combination of these to help narrow down the best martial arts style for you.
- Check Proximity and Class Times: Choose a martial arts school near your Christchurch neighborhood—such as Halswell, Rolleston, or the CBD—with class times that fit your schedule for better long-term commitment.
- Trial a Class First: Most schools offer free or low-cost trial classes—these are great for experiencing the environment, teaching style, and community before making a commitment.
- Assess Instructor Credentials: Look for instructors with verifiable experience and recognized certifications to ensure high-quality, safe instruction.
- Evaluate Facility Conditions: Clean, well-equipped training environments with safety mats, gear, and spacious layouts contribute to a positive learning experience.
- Consider Age-Specific Programs: Schools offering programs tailored to kids, teens, or adults can better address developmental stages and specific learning needs.
Frequently Asked Questions About Christchurch Martial Arts Schools
What age is appropriate to start martial arts training in Christchurch?
Most martial arts schools in Christchurch offer beginner programs for children as young as 3 or 4 years old. Programs are typically structured by age group to ensure they align with developmental milestones and learning capacity.
How often should I or my child attend martial arts classes?
For optimal progress, attending classes 1–3 times per week is common. Attendance can vary depending on individual goals, with some students increasing frequency for competition training or rapid skill development.
What martial arts styles are commonly taught in Christchurch?
Christchurch schools frequently teach a wide range of styles including Karate, Taekwondo,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u (BJJ), Muay Thai, Kung Fu, and Krav Maga. Many academies also offer mixed or freestyle systems that blend multiple techniques for practical self-defense.
Are martial arts classes in Christchurch suitable for women and families?
Yes, many Christchurch martial arts schools offer women-only classes, as well as family-friendly programs designed for all ages. These classes often focus on empowerment, self-confidence, and community, making them inclusive for everyone.
Do I need to be fit before starting martial arts?
No prior fitness level is required to begin martial arts in Christchurch. Most schools welcome beginners and gradually build fitness and skill through structured programs that accommodate all levels of ability.
